APC gov. arrests, detains baby after retiree father sends SMS plea
A six-month-old baby, her sister, father, and mother have sued Kebbi’s governor and the Department of State Services for arrest and detention for 13 days without trial.
The family of four were arrested Sept. 1 in Yauri, and were kept in custody till Sept. 13.
Abdulrahman Nasir Jato, Hadiza Nasir Jato, Aisha Zakari and the six-month-old baby were arrested in their house by DSS operatives for allegedly texting Governor Atiku Bagudu to pay their father’s gratuity.
Justice Bassey Onu Sunday of the Federal High Court at Birnin-Kebbi has adjourned the case for ruling.
No date announced.
